#0cf75d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0cf75d is composed of 4.7% red, 96.9%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.3%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 140.7 degrees, a saturation of 93.6% and a lightness of 50.8%. #0cf75d color hex could be obtained by blending #18ffba with #00ef00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ff66.

Shades and Tints of #0cf75d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000401 is the darkest color, while #f0fff5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#0cf75d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#808381 is the less saturated color, while #0cf75d is the most saturated one.
